Abstract

It is possible to say that after presenting a description of the religious architecture of Dur- Kurekalzu, that the Kassite were clearly influenced by the religion of Mesopotamia. Despite the simple developments they have made in the field of the stairs of the zakora and terraces, which represented two unique cases that did not exist previously, There is a kind of evolution of the religious architecture in this city that represents them, as can be inferred through the allocation of the temples of the goddess of ancient Mesopotamia, and quote many of the architectural details of the building.                   .
